Job description Job title Responsible to Responsible for Department Team Remit of post covers Salary Hours of work Located at Type of contract: Head of Direct Marketing Head of Public Fundraising Senior Direct Marketing Officer (retention), Senior Direct Marketing Officer (acquisition), Direct Marketing Officer, Direct Marketing Officer (part time) Fundraising Direct Marketing England and Wales Grade F of Mind s salary scales 35 hours per week, full time Stratford Permanent Purpose and scope of the job We re Mind, the mental health charity. We won t give up until everyone experiencing a mental health problem gets support and respect. We provide advice and support to empower anybody experiencing a mental health problem and we campaign to improve services, raise awareness and promote understanding. You will be responsible for the development and management of the Direct Marketing strategy, programme and plans, maximising all opportunities for income generation to achieve income targets. You will develop the current donor base and plan and implement the recruitment of new donors, reporting regularly on progress. To achieve this you will shape and deliver an exciting multi-channel programme of campaigns. This will be carried out through the day to day management and co-ordination of the direct marketing team, outside specialist agencies and in liaison with Mind specialist staff. The Direct Marketing team sits within the Public Fundraising unit and raises 3.4 million income per year for Mind. You will report to the Head of Public Fundraising and you will line manage a team. You will need to work closely with other staff in the team and department. You will be contributing to the overall success of the Fundraising department. Key responsibilities Direct Marketing Programme 1. Develop a strategic DM plan and long-term growth budgets. This covers existing donors and the recruitment of new donors with the purpose of raising funds and establishing future income streams. 2. To prepare forecasts, set and manage annual budgets and take responsibility for achieving annual target income taking particularly care to manage and keep expenditure for DM within budget. 3. Develop, deliver, manage and oversee an annual programme of campaigns using digital marketing, direct mail and telemarketing, to recruit new cash donors and regular givers. 4. Optimise opportunities through data segmentation, supporter journey development, cross sell, new products and propositions and optimisation of current programme. 5. Ensure that all campaigns, publications and materials fall within the Mind s tone of voice and brand guidelines. 6. To develop, maintain and produce statistical reports and financial analyses necessary for direct marketing decision making analyse results and use findings in future selection decision-making. 7. To lead on identifying and advising on trends and activities for potential areas for income growth that impact on longer term strategic developments and feed these into the Public Fundraising Strategy as directed. 8. To appoint, negotiate and decide on the activities to be performed by outside specialist agencies and to manage these specialist agencies to ensure effective coordination between Mind and each other. 9. To manage customer care programmes for DM activity to ensure highest levels of customer care to various audiences. 10. To manage work with other teams within Fundraising to ensure effective collaboration and proactively maximise potential of income streams for Mind. 11. To manage developments in Direct Marketing and related legal requirements and ensure that the direct marketing programme is carried out within the letter and spirit of the law, and in conformity with guidance from relevant authorities. Line Management 12. Responsible for the line management and development of Four DM staff. This includes regular supervision, training and appraisals as per Mind s policy.

Person Specification: Head of Direct Marketing Essential criteria Experience 1. Substantial demonstrable fundraising experience in direct marketing including donor relationship management and using databases within direct marketing. 2. Substantial project management experience including monitoring and evaluation. 3. Substantial experience of achieving objectives and targets including income/fundraising targets. 4. Substantial experience of managing a team including supervisions, appraisals, delegating, supporting and developing. 5. Excellent proven track record in charity appeals marketing online and offline (Acquisition and retention) 6. Experience of developing strategies, policies, programmes and plans of work. 7. Experience of managing third party agencies and suppliers. 8. Planning and developing income generation through direct marketing against an annual target, and a track record of success in achieving this. 9. Planning, developing and managing budgets including forecasting, summarising and analysing, monitoring and regular reporting of outcome against target. 10. Educated to degree level and/or relevant professional qualification (or equivalent by experience) Skills 1. Proven analytical skills to evaluate opportunities 2. Excellent interpersonal and communication skills in English. 3. Excellent IT skills including using MS office packages, internet and using databases as relevant to role. Knowledge 1. Up to date and detailed knowledge of fundraising approaches and techniques and specifically in direct marketing 2. Working knowledge of using databases and spreadsheets and how they are used in fundraising. 3. Knowledge of digital marketing techniques.
